The US Army Medical Research Acquisition Activity (USAMRAA) on behalf of US Army Medical Research Institute of Chemical Defense, Aberdeen Proving Ground, MD, requests responses from qualified sources capable of providing preventative maintenance services and "as needed" repairs on Thermo Fisher ArrayScan VTI and XTI instruments and corresponding cameras on the following equipment; Item Model Serial # Thermo Fisher ArrayScan XTI 06168337M (Associated Thermo Fisher ArrayScan Camera) XTI A17A849006 Thermo Fisher ArrayScan XTI 06168338M (Associated Thermo Fisher ArrayScan Camera) XTI A17A849009 Thermo Fisher ArrayScan VTI 06107114F 1. Provide all maintenance and repair service for two (2) Thermo Fisher ArrayScan XTI instruments and one (1) Thermo Fisher ArrayScan VTI instrument, to include at least one preventive maintenance visit per year. 2. Schedule one on-site preventative maintenance visit per calendar year at the request of the customer, to achieve the following: a. Provide instrument performance testing and optimization. b. Identify and perform repairs. c. Provide software updates and upgrades and give instructions on the impact and use the new software features. Provide software updates and upgrades to client software, if needed. d. Upon notification, coordinate with the customer to provide on-site repair services for system breakdown or faulty system operation with objective to minimize instrument downtime. e. The Government and the contractor's service representative will exchange hazard communication information before the commencement of any repair. 3. When required, the contractor's service representative shall comply with the Office of Safety and Health Administration (OSHA) lockout/tag-out standards while performing maintenance on Medical Device/Medical Device System. 4. Provide service within a timely manner: Reply to service requests within 3 hours and must schedule a time to be on-site within 72 hours of the initiation of a service request. Field service engineers must be on-site, within three business days of the initiation of a request, to assess and resolve a service request. Telephone service support must be available during normal business hours, excluding federal holidays. The original manufacturer parts on hand or can obtain and install original manufacturer parts within 5 business days are required. If timelines cannot be fulfilled, reasoning must be provided and must be approved by the COR. 5. Comprehensive coverage shall be included. To include the responsibility for all training, labor, travel, and parts costs regardless of frequency during the contract term. Parts include, but are not limited to, those needed to operate Thermo Fisher ArrayScan XTI and VTI instruments and items listed under the scope of contract. 6. Service technicians and engineers must be Thermo Fisher certified: All Technicians and Engineers must have experience and be certified to work on Thermo Fisher ArrayScan XTI and VTI instruments. Proof of certification must be provided to the contract Contracting Officer Representative. Technicians and Engineers must have instant access to current hardware and software updates to maximize service life. 7. Service representatives shall be factory trained from Thermo Fisher on ArrayScan VTI and XTI systems and have a minimum of two years of experience working on the contracted Medical Device/Medical Device System and shall be a citizen of the United States. 8.
